So my sister is a pink freak and I want to make her a ballpoint that will take easy to find pink refills. She'll be using it to grade papers at school (math teacher) and she says grading in pink makes her happy. She hates grading so she needs something to make it pleasurable. :)

I have no clue about what kits would have a refill I could find in pink. I so rarely work with kits (except those cool sketch pencils) and I almost never use ballpoints or roller balls, so I really don't have much of a clue as to what is out there.

Of course it will be teamed up with an interesting pink blank. :)

If a capped pen is not out of the equation ;) a Schmidt Cartridge Rolling Writer would work. It uses the same feed thread as the #5 Schmidt Fountain pen feed. They can be interchanged. It would give her the option of using fountain pen inks. Either cartridges or converter and bottled ink. You could probably make a semester sized bulb filler with your talents. :)
